If you get the chance I'd be grateful if you can review some changes
that I've just made in the swing module.

The reason that the Quickstart app needed JAI at runtime was because
grid coverage classes were referenced directly by the InfoTool class.
I've think I've fixed this by hiding the grid coverage classes in a
helper class that is loaded by reflection if required.

It seems to work but this is the first time that I've ventured into
controlling class loading so I'd appreciate you having a look at the
new InfoTool code to make sure I haven't stuffed something up.
